Minnetrista Cultural Center and Oakhurst Gardens, located in Muncie,
Indiana, is seeking an individual with a bachelor's degree in education
and at least three years experience in education.  This position will
develop, implement and evaluate educational programming that will serve
schools, teachers, students, interpreters and lifelong learners.  Serve
as primary liaison to the educational community.  Support exhibits and
collections with programming.  Must be child oriented, flexible and able
to work successfully with all learning styles.  Strong oral/written
communication and organizational skills.  Exceptional computer skills,
and able to speak to large and small groups with ease.  Familiar with
and support inquiry-based education.  Minnetrista Cultural Center and
Oakhurst Gardens is located on the north bank of the White River in the
city limits.  Just a few minutes from Ball State University, it offers a
wide variety of exhibits, events and programs for residents of East
Central Indiana and beyond.  Each month brings new things to see and do.
